I was honored that one of my favorite online music magazines, Americana Highways, reviewed the album. Music reviewer John Apice had these very kind words to say about it: 

[The album] has material as pleasing as work by the likes of Joni Mitchell mixed with doses of Emmylou Harris & Beth Nielsen-Chapman. It’s a tightly constructed LP with every day occurrences (“All Burned Out” & “Call My Heart Home”) that incorporate feelings, reminisces & would resonate with listeners. 

Read the entire review here. Writing for Americana UK, music critic Graeme Tait offered these thoughts: 

With 'Heart On A Wire,' Shulman has done enough to confidently propel herself to the next level as a singer-songwriter, displaying an acute and highly individual lyrical narrative.

Carolyn Shulman & Sarah Golden met on the local music scene while they both lived in Houston, Texas more than 25 years ago, and they became fast friends. Now, though they no longer live in the same city (Carolyn moved to Denver in 2014), both Carolyn & Sarah have become critically acclaimed singer-songwriters, recording artists, and performers. Sarah is fresh off her win at the 2026 Kerrville Folk Festival's New Folk Songwriting Contest, and she was featured on Season 2 of NBC's The Voice (Team CeeLo). Carolyn is a former finalist in the Rocky Mountain Folks Festival's Songwriter Showcase, and both of her full length albums landed on the FAI Folk Radio Charts. Come see them perform at Trident Booksellers & Cafe, and you will feel like you've stepped into a casual living room where two old friends are trading songs and stories. You will love their easy camaraderie and rapport onstage just as much as you will love their songs! It's a free, all ages show, outside on the back patio (covered seating available).
